Press Release: Montgomery & Prince George’s Hospice Appoints Dr. Lee-Anne West as Chief Executive Officer

June 23, 2026


Montgomery & Prince George’s Hospice Appoints New Chief Executive Officer

Rockville, MD, June 23, 2026— Montgomery & Prince George’s Hospice is pleased to announce that Dr. Lee-Anne West has been appointed Chief Executive Officer by the organization’s Board of Directors following her service as Interim CEO since January 2026.

A respected physician executive with extensive experience in hospice and palliative care, Dr. West has provided steady leadership during an important period of transition while helping to position the organization for future growth and long-term sustainability.

“Dr. West has demonstrated exceptional leadership, compassion, and strategic vision during her time as Interim CEO,” said Justin G. Reaves, Chair of the Board of Directors for Montgomery & Prince George’s Hospice. “The Board has full confidence in her ability to lead this organization into its next chapter while remaining deeply committed to the mission and values that have guided Montgomery & Prince George’s Hospice for 45 years. Her clinical expertise, operational experience, and unwavering commitment to patient-centered care make her uniquely suited for this role.”

Dr. West brings more than two decades of healthcare leadership experience spanning hospice, palliative medicine, clinical operations, inpatient care, and primary care. She most recently served as Associate Chief Medical Officer and Senior Vice President of Clinical Operations for Capital Caring Health, where she oversaw medical and clinical staff across Maryland, Washington, DC, and Virginia programs.

Prior to that role, Dr. West served as a Medical Director overseeing inpatient hospice units at Capital Caring Health and previously held leadership positions with Seasons Hospice (now AccentCare) in Maryland. Earlier in her career, she worked as an inpatient hospitalist, medical faculty member, and outpatient primary care physician.

Dr. West is a dual board-certified physician through the American Board of Internal Medicine (ABIM) in both internal medicine, and hospice and palliative medicine. She earned her medical degree from St. Christopher’s College of Medicine in Luton, United Kingdom, and holds a Bachelor of Science in Nursing from East Stroudsburg University in Pennsylvania.

“It is a tremendous honor to continue serving Montgomery & Prince George’s Hospice in this new capacity,” said Dr. West. “Over the past year, I have had the privilege of witnessing firsthand the extraordinary compassion and dedication of our staff, volunteers, donors, and community partners. As we celebrate our 45th anniversary under the theme ‘Lighting the Way,’ I look forward to building upon our strong foundation while expanding access to compassionate hospice and palliative care for the communities we serve.”

As CEO, Dr. West’s priorities will include strengthening access to hospice and palliative care services, investing in staff education and professional development, deepening community engagement, and ensuring the organization’s long-term financial sustainability.

About Montgomery & Prince George’s Hospice

Montgomery & Prince George’s Hospice is an independent community-based non-profit organization serving residents in Maryland since 1981. Its mission is to gentle the journey through serious illness and loss with skill and compassion. Accredited by Community Health Accreditation Partners (CHAP), the organization’s goals are to bring comfort by providing the best care to individuals who are facing serious illness and loss and to be the best workplace for staff and volunteers. Under the umbrella of Montgomery Hospice & Prince George’s Hospice are Casey House, a 14-bed inpatient facility and Palliative Medicine Consultants of Greater Washington.
